It features a strong roster from two of probably the most beloved firms as well as their franchises. Then there’s the artwork that treats all People admirer favorites good. And, a lot of all, Top Marvel vs Capcom 3 contains a wondrously complicated tag-team fighting system as deep and varied as any sport while in the fighting sport Local communit… Read More